#23b7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23b7ea is composed of 13.7% red, 71.8%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 195.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 52.7%. #23b7ea color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#006fd5.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#23b7ea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#23b7ea has RGB values of R:35, G:183,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 2340842.

Hex triplet 23b7ea #23b7ea
RGB Decimal 35, 183, 234 rgb(35,183,234)
RGB Percent 13.7, 71.8, 91.8 rgb(13.7%,71.8%,91.8%)
CMYK 85, 22, 0, 8
HSL 195.4°, 82.6, 52.7 hsl(195.4,82.6%,52.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 195.4°, 85, 91.8
Web Safe 33ccff #33ccff
CIE-LAB 69.585, -19.355, -35.781
XYZ 32.474, 40.162, 83.878
xyY 0.207, 0.257, 40.162
CIE-LCH 69.585, 40.68, 241.59
CIE-LUV 69.585, -46.423, -54.835
Hunter-Lab 63.373, -19.436, -34.112
Binary 00100011, 10110111, 11101010

Shades and Tints of #23b7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0d is the darkest color, while #fafd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#23b7ea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808a8d is the less saturated color, while #10c0fd is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#23b7ea is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#919191 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7b99a3 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#9eace1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#93acf0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00bfcc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#71b0e4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#6ab0ee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#0cbcd7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
